Typically, 1.5 to 2 inches of head or body hair is necessary for testing. These analyses can reveal drugs, alcohol/ETG, and provide other tailored hair testing solutions.

Lately, the approach to conducting drug examinations has increasingly involved hair follicle analysis. Numerous employers, legal venues, and substance monitoring experts now mandate these tests over traditional urine testing. Hair follicle screenings benefit those with strict no-drug-use policies, legal systems, and individuals under probation, with a detection period extending up to 90 days, collected under supervision, making circumvention nearly impossible. Yet, for recent drug use detection within five days, urine testing remains unmatched.

What it is, How it works

Hair screening is increasingly recognized as an effective method for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air retains a long-term record of substance use by embedding biomarkers within its strands. When clipped near the scalp, hair can offer an approximate three-month detection period for substances. The collection process is straightforward, challenging to tamper with, and easily transportable.

A 1.5-inch hair sample, roughly equating to 200 strands (similar in size to a #2 pencil), taken near the scalp, provides 100mg of hair, which is ideal for both screening and validation. For tests involving EtG, additional panels, or more than 10 panels, 150mg is advised. It's recommended to use a jeweler’s scale to measure the sample. If scalp hair can't be obtained, an equivalent quantity of body hair is acceptable. References to head hair pertain solely to scalp hair. Body hair encompasses all other types (facial, axillary, etc.).

Process Overview

The laboratory's analysis of a drug test consists of four crucial phases: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

Accessioning is the initial phase where a sample is processed into a lab's system. This step includes ensuring the sample was properly sealed and transported, assigning an arbitrary L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and filling in any missing data that is not covered by an electronic custody system.

Screening involves a preliminary assessment for drugs. While it's a cost-efficient method to identify drug presence in most samples, a positive Screening requires verification for legal admissibility. Samples with presumptive positive results from Screening need further confirmation.

For samples with a presumptive positive result in Screening, additional hair is obtained from the initial batch and prepared for Extraction. In this phase, substances are extracted from hair at much lower concentrations compared to other methods (e.g., urine or saliva), making hair drug screening one of the most challenging to execute.

G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S are used for confirming positive Screening outcomes. Before confirmation, all presumptive positive samples undergo washing as necessary. Each step of the lab process from Accessioning to Confirmation adheres to both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and the 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ection period: Hair drug tests can identify drug use for up to 90 days, unlike urine tests, which have a shorter span.
  • Resistance to manipulation: Hair drug tests are difficult to deceive, leading to more reliable results.
  • Offers historical insight: Hair tests can show a pattern of substance use over time, not just recent activity.

Limitations:

  • Inability to detect recent usage: It typically takes 5-7 days for substances to become detectable in hair.
  • Expense: Hair drug screens tend to cost more than other testing methods.
  • Result variability: Factors like hair color and personal hair growth differences can influence drug metabolite concentrations.

Note: Although often termed "hair follicle tests", the procedure actually analyzes the hair strand itself, not the follicles underneath the scalp.
